# ValidatorHub plugin loader config — heads up, security folks
#
# This env file drives the plugin system for Corrindale's data validators.
# Each validator plugin is fetched from our internal registry at boot,
# checksummed, then sandboxed before it touches any pipeline data.
# Nothing here grants write access to production datasets — plugins are
# read-only by design, enforced in the loader itself.
# The only sensitive bit is the registry credential the loader uses to
# pull signed plugin bundles. It gets set on the very next line:

vault entry, yajep-fajop: ARCHIVE_KEY3=4c0

Vendor note: Ledgerfern, our spreadsheet-export vendor, reported that large exports (over 200k rows) spike worker memory to near container limits, risking OOM kills and truncated files. They propose a streaming writer in their next release; until then we cap export size at 150k rows. Security-relevant detail: truncation is silent, so exported audit spreadsheets may be incomplete — verify row counts against source. Their incident liaison handles verification requests and disclosure questions.

alerts address for kajog-tadup: druox@plorvanet.internal

## Deploy step 4: Bulk edits in the admin table

Before enabling bulk edits on the Cartloom admin table, run the migration that adds the audit column. Bulk operations refuse to start without it. Then push the updated admin bundle through the Stagegate deploy tool. Stagegate requires every push to be signed; unsigned bundles are dropped silently, so don't skip this. Sign with the support team's deploy key, shown below.

rollout seal: bky4_yke3

## Formula sandbox tuning

User-supplied formulas in Gridmoor execute inside a restricted interpreter with hard ceilings on time, memory, and call depth. Reviewers should confirm any change to these ceilings is justified in the PR description, since raising them widens the abuse surface. Defaults were chosen from production traces. The current limits are as follows.

limits module of tafog-fawip:
WEIGHTS = {
    "julix": 57,
    "lamys": 992,
    "kasvan": 209,
    "quenok": 750,
    "alddor": 259,
    "oliath": 1009,
    "wenix": 815,
}